## Config Hot-Reload — Brimfold Gateway

The gateway watches its config directory and applies changes without restarts. Contractors should edit only the staging overlay; production files are managed by the release pipeline. Every reloaded config must carry a valid signature or the watcher ignores it silently. To sign your staging configs, use the team's current signing key shown below:

rollout seal: bky4_x7Gc

RateGuard, our hotel rate-parity checker, runs in three environments: dev, staging, and production. Dev scrapes a fixture set of invented hotel listings; staging hits a sandboxed partner feed; production polls live channels on a throttled schedule. Reviewers should note that parity thresholds differ per environment — staging is deliberately looser to surface edge cases without paging anyone. Environment promotion requires a config diff in the PR description. For completeness, staging currently runs with the configuration values below.

settings of bawif-fawif:
ralix:
  log_level: warn
  metrics_host: metrics.ralix.tolvaqsys.internal
  pool_size: 32

Subject: Second-source supplier search — quick update

Hi all,

Quick heads-up for finance: we've kicked off the hunt for a backup supplier for the Veltrix resin line. Our sole-source setup with Corrano Materials has been fine, but the pricing risk is getting uncomfortable. We've shortlisted three candidates and expect sample runs next month. Budget impact should be modest, though qualification testing isn't free. Full cost model coming Friday. One more thing you should see before the board deck goes out.

internal memo for kawip-hadug: Headcount on the Wenwyn team goes from 7 to 140 by the end of January. Gross margin on Wenwyn came in at 20 percent against a plan of 15 percent.